    IEE and SnT develop the first radar-based child detection system for cars 

    It’s a small signal with a big impact: the first radar-based system that detects children left in vehicles. A breakthrough in automotive safety born from academic-industry collaboration.

    Tele-Operated Driving for Highly Automated Vehicles (5GDrive)

    The 5GDrive project, led by SnT at the University of Luxembourg along with collaborators POST Luxembourg and Ohmio, targets the ambitious goal of developing and validating a tele-operated driving system for autonomous vehicles utilizing cutting-edge 5G technology.
